Script In English:
The radio commercial ’Berlin’. (SFX: A Hip Hop beat in the background.)(An interesting narrator’s voice:)Somewhere on a street in Berlin.She is running on the sidewalk.He is driving in his car. She is a divorce lawyer.He is a corporate lawyer.She is called ’Man of the year’ by her colleagues.He is called ’The Cannibal’ by his.She does kickboxing for relaxation for four years now.He trains mixed martial arts three times a week.She is opening her sixth energy drink of the day.He just had a bloody steak for lunch.She is crossing to the other side of the road.He is reaching for his sunglases in the glove compartment and ... (SFX: The loud beeping sound of the Volkswagen Pedestrian Monitoring System.)(The narrator continues:)Thanks to the Pedestrian Monitoring System from Volkswagen these two people will never meet. Fortunately.(Off-Speaker:)Volkswagen.
Synopsis:
In our spot ‘Berlin’ we tell the story of two people moving along the same street. A female divorce lawyer walking on the sidewalk. And a corporate lawyer driving in his car. With every sentence, we notice that these two people are really ruthless and that they should better never meet.At the end of the story, the divorce lawyer steps on to the street and the corporate lawyer as the equally distracted driver hurtles towards him, we dissolve to:Thanks to Pedestrian Monitoring System from Volkswagen these two people will never meet. Fortunately.
